Subject: SpoolPort cut-over complete

Plugin authors: the cut-over to SpoolPort 2.x finished last night. Legacy spooler endpoints are gone. Plugins compiled against the 1.x SDK must rebuild against the new print-job schema before Friday. Queue semantics unchanged; retry behavior is not. Test against the staging spooler first. The staging instance runs with the following configuration.

deployment values, faduf-tawep:
SORDOR_LOG_LEVEL=error
SORDOR_METRICS_HOST=metrics.sordor.nelvrolabs.internal
SORDOR_POOL_SIZE=4

Hey Mirna — the three Quellix demo units came back from the Tarnwood trade fair this morning. They're boxed up by my desk, cables and stands included, though one stand is missing a thumb screw (flagged on the sticker). Driver needs to run them over to the Quellix showroom before Friday. Brief the driver on the hand-over line below before they leave.

dispatch memo: the lamwyn fenwyn courier leaves the wenir ledger at gate 7175 under passcode 822969

Quotas for the Cloudmarrow alert fan-out, so future-you doesn't rediscover them the hard way. The pusher shards by county code, and each shard has its own token bucket — blowing past it doesn't error, it just queues, which is worse because stale weather alerts are useless. The downstream Nimblecast gateway also enforces a global ceiling, so don't raise our per-shard caps without asking that team first. Everything's defined in one place now, and the current values are listed right below.

tuning constants:
QUOTAS = {
    "druwyn": 5,
    "holix": 5,
    "zorath": 5,
    "holwyn": 10,
}

Subject: idempotency keys for payment retries — heads up

Hi all (and welcome, new folks on the Tarnley contract!). Starting this release, every retry through the Opaline payments gateway must carry an idempotency key, or the gateway rejects it. Retries without keys caused the duplicate-charge mess last sprint. The release that enforces this is stamped with the token below.

build token for kagaf-hahof: htk14_9d3d4d26d7d8de